This weblog publish aims to supply an in depth, move-by-phase guidebook regarding how to develop an SSH essential pair for authenticating Linux servers and programs that assist SSH protocol employing SSH-keygen.
Which means that your local Computer system does not understand the remote host. This may occur The very first time you hook up with a different host. Type Of course and press ENTER to continue.
Be aware that the password it's essential to supply Here's the password to the person account you are logging into. This is simply not the passphrase you've got just created.
With that, when you run ssh it will eventually look for keys in Keychain Obtain. If it finds just one, you'll no longer be prompted for a password. Keys will even immediately be additional to ssh-agent whenever you restart your machine.
In case you are On this place, the passphrase can prevent the attacker from instantly logging into your other servers. This will hopefully Provide you with time to create and carry out a different SSH vital pair and remove access with the compromised vital.
Your computer accesses your private essential and decrypts the message. It then sends its individual encrypted information again into the remote Personal computer. Amongst other items, this encrypted concept has the session ID which was been given within the remote Personal computer.
It's advised to incorporate your e mail handle as an identifier, even though it's not necessary to do that on Home windows since Microsoft's Edition routinely takes advantage of your username and also the title of the Laptop for this.
Each and every system has its own actions and issues. Building numerous SSH keys for different internet sites is simple — just give Just about every vital a different name throughout the generation method. Control and transfer these keys appropriately to stop getting rid of use of servers and accounts.
ed25519 - it is a new algorithm included in OpenSSH. Assist for it in clients will not be but common. Therefore its use usually objective purposes might not nonetheless be recommended.
Basically all cybersecurity regulatory frameworks have to have controlling who will accessibility what. SSH keys grant access, and tumble beneath this necessity. This, corporations beneath compliance mandates are required to carry out suitable management procedures for your keys. NIST IR 7966 is a superb starting point.
Observe: If a file While using the exact identify now exists, you will end up questioned whether you want to overwrite the file.
These Guidance have been tested on Ubuntu, Fedora, and Manjaro distributions of Linux. In all scenarios the process was similar, and there was no need to set up any new computer software on any from the take a look at machines.
On general purpose computers, randomness for SSH important generation is usually not a problem. It could be a little something of a difficulty when in the beginning putting in the SSH server and creating host keys, and only men and women creating new Linux distributions or SSH installation packages frequently have to have to bother with it.
three. You may use the default identify for that keys, or you may opt for additional descriptive names to assist you to distinguish concerning keys For anyone who is working with a number of essential pairs. To follow the default createssh choice, push Enter.